The event is a party with friends and their friends, too, probably about 40 people. It will be an educated and urban crowd. We are having Bacalao for dinner, and will chat and dance into the wee hours afterwards. This is not happening every month in my life

I very early decided that I want to wear my new Boss LBD because it is very sleek and neutral, and has great fit. I asked you to help me style it, and you gave me food for thought. Thank you for making my head spin

Because of my love for retro elements, I tried knitting a shrug in a mid-toned blue to bridge the Winter and Spring seasons. The shrug turned out to be a detour. It received mixed opinions in the forum, and that is of course just fine. I like the shrug as it is. The breaking point for me, however, was that I didn't feel like me in it, particularly not with this dress. My style descriptor is Queen Modern Classic. I also have an arty/playful aspect to my style, but it is not necessarily retro even though I love retro elements in outfits in general.

I decided to wear an outfit that better represents ME, with emphasis on Modern, Classic and with a hint of Playful. Other limitations included Angie's advice of not going all black, particularly not now in Spring, and that I didn't want to buy anything new for this occasion since I've been shopping enough lately, and I will rather spend my money on my daily wear.

The final result:
#1 LBD with fuchsia clutch and black snakeskin embossed pumps (closed toes are best, it is still very cold at night, and I need a hose).
#2 LBD with black leather bomber and close up of the clutch
#3 The addition of a silk scarf in blues, greens, purples and browns. Will stay on or left off in accordance with the temperature.
#4 Accesories: A thin silver chain necklace, sparkly silver earrings, a ring clustered with silver pearls. Side view of the dress.
#5 Accessories II: Scarf, clutch, ring, earring, shoes, black micro fishnet. I might swap the hose for a sheer black hose with small pin dots
#6 Two alternatives for outerwear, depending on the weather/temperature. I do need a larger bag anyway, so I will probably be wearing the black tote with the fuchsia clutch inside along with the shoes.
#7 Final result: LBD with scarf, bomber, clutch and accessories
